Demand for the fresh produce may be switching courses

Caio Alves
Published 2022년 3월 3일
Reportedly, fresh produce is being led to containers 'afloat' and to increase potential transshipment, generating constraints in the Black sea region. The East European countries are seeing some meaningful price declines in retail, and the canceling of bookings might affect until demand balances back up again. The sanctions against Russia should be suppressed further in the upcoming days and offer no guarantees that cargoes already on the water will make it through St. Petersburg’s main gateway port. Odessa, Ukraine, is also out of operations due to the war. That is likely to leave thousands of containers onboard vessels and to enlarge the gridlock portion of Europe’s already congested marine terminals.
